。
这个警告通常表示在iOS部署目标设置中选择了较低的版本,但项目中使用了较高版本的API或框架。这可能导致在较低版本的iOS设备上无法正常运行或出现功能缺失。
为了解决这个问题,可以采取以下步骤:
- 检查项目中使用的API或框架的最低支持版本:查看项目中使用的各个库、框架或API的文档,确定它们的最低支持版本。确保选择的iOS部署目标版本高于这些最低支持版本。
- 更新iOS部署目标版本:在Xcode中,选择项目的主目标,然后在"General"选项卡中找到"Deployment Info"部分。将"Deployment Target"设置为适当的iOS版本,以确保与项目中使用的API或框架兼容。
- 适配较低版本的设备:如果项目中使用的API或框架在较低版本的iOS设备上不可用,可以考虑使用条件编译或运行时检查来适配不同的iOS版本。这样可以在较低版本的设备上提供替代功能或回退方案。
- 测试和验证:在进行任何更改后,务必进行全面的测试和验证,以确保项目在不同版本的iOS设备上都能正常运行,并且没有出现可用性警告。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云移动应用托管:提供了一站式的移动应用托管服务,支持iOS和Android应用的自动化构建、部署和管理。详情请参考:腾讯云移动应用托管
- 腾讯云移动推送:为移动应用提供消息推送服务,支持iOS和Android平台,可以实现个性化推送、定时推送等功能。详情请参考:腾讯云移动推送
- 腾讯云移动测试:提供了一站式的移动应用测试服务,支持iOS和Android应用的自动化测试、性能测试和兼容性测试等。详情请参考:腾讯云移动测试
请注意,以上仅为腾讯云提供的部分相关产品,其他云计算品牌商也提供类似的解决方案,但根据要求不能提及。